My Buying Guides on Red Ipad Keyboard Case

Why I Look for a Red iPad Keyboard Case

When I shop for a red iPad keyboard case, I want something that does more than just look good. The red color adds a bold, stylish touch, but I also care about protection, typing comfort, and how well it fits my iPad. For me, the best case is one that balances appearance with everyday usefulness.

Compatibility Comes First

The first thing I check is whether the case matches my exact iPad model. I never assume that one case fits all iPads, because the size, camera placement, and button positions can vary. I always compare the product details with my iPad generation before buying.

Keyboard Quality Matters to Me

I pay close attention to the keyboard because I use it for typing notes, emails, and messages. I prefer keys that feel responsive and comfortable, with enough spacing so I don’t make mistakes. If the keyboard is backlit, that is even better for me when I work in low light.

Protection Is Important

I want my iPad to be safe from scratches, bumps, and minor drops. A good keyboard case should cover the corners well and have a sturdy outer shell. I also like a case that keeps my screen protected when I close it.

Battery Life and Connectivity

If the keyboard is Bluetooth-enabled, I check how long the battery lasts and how easy it is to reconnect. I prefer a case that pairs quickly and holds a charge for a long time. For me, a reliable connection is essential because I do not want interruptions while typing.

Adjustable Viewing Angles

I like a keyboard case that lets me adjust the screen to different angles. This helps me when I’m typing, watching videos, or reading. A flexible stand makes the case much more useful in my daily routine.

Material and Build Quality

I always look at the material because it affects both durability and comfort. I like a case that feels solid but not too heavy. The red finish should also be smooth, attractive, and resistant to wear so it keeps looking good over time.

Portability and Weight

Since I carry my iPad often, I prefer a keyboard case that is lightweight and easy to travel with. A bulky case can be inconvenient, especially if I use my iPad on the go. I try to find one that protects well without adding too much weight.

Extra Features I Appreciate

I enjoy useful extras like a pencil holder, auto sleep/wake support, shortcut keys, or a detachable keyboard. These small features can make a big difference in how convenient the case feels. I usually choose the one that gives me the most value for my needs.
